Clients may prefer that specific job is taken care of by a clever associate for a reduced hourly rate. A firm will in some cases hire outdoors lawyers as independent service providers to do part-time work. The firm will generally pay an agreement lawyer on a per hour basis and then costs out his/her time at a higher rate in order to cover above costs and hopefully earn a profit.
Lots of firms will also develop an affiliation with several lawyers under an "of guidance" plan. The sorts of setups that can be called "of advice" are sometimes hard to nicely specify, yet it is usually something greater than a part-time having relationship. For instance, an attorney that is semi-retired might proceed a relationship with his/her company on an "of counsel" basis instead of remaining a partner.

Paralegals can offer a very important function in a law office by giving crucial assistance to lawyers when they are working on situations (Milford NH elder law firm). In lots of instances, paralegals have a practical functioning understanding of the regulation and of court or administrative procedures that makes them useful to a law company. They have the ability to function under the supervision of a lawyer on the detail work that needs to be done on every case yet that can not validate the high payment rates of an attorney
These obligations and demands can be a huge diversion for an attorney that doesn't have a skilled legal assistant to arrange and aid with the day-to-day affairs of his/her technique. Depending on the legislation company, "legal aide" and "lawful assistant" are often interchangeable titles. Depending upon the kind of regulation they exercise, some regulation firms will employ their very own private investigators that explore history realities on a case.

Regulation firms bill customers for the time legal representatives invest working on instances. Companies might incorporate hourly rates with retainer fees, which are upfront charges paid by customers to law methods to secure solutions for a certain situation or a particular timeframe.
